Craspedia canens


Herb with stiff green to purplish woolly lance-shaped flower stems (usually one but up to five), to 65 cm. Yellow globular flowers to 25 mm across. Leaves mainly at base in a rosette, 6-25 cm long, 5-15 mm wide, evenly grey-green with long fine white hairs on top, sparsely whitish hairy underneath.

Distinctive Features

Yellow globular flowers held on long stalks over hairy grey-green mostly basal leaves.

Biology

Perennial. Widespread in wet or dry situations, and in swamps, mostly in the lowlands.

Similar Species

Pycnosorus is distinguished from the similar Craspedia species by looking at the tiny yellow flowers that make up the flowerhead. In Craspedia they are on a little stalk and in Pycnosorus there is no stem.
